Q: How does `rotorkey`, Bramvale's secrets-rotation utility, recover from a failed rotation? A: It keeps the prior secret in the Vexley escrow bucket for 24 hours. Run `rotorkey rollback --stage` and confirm checksums before promoting. Never edit escrow entries by hand; maintainers before you broke prod that way. The rollback prompt requires the escrow recovery passphrase, which is kept directly below this entry.

strongbox words: fraath-isteth

- [ ] Step 7: Archive cold storage buckets (Glacierline tier). Confirm both ceremony witnesses are present, verify bucket manifests match the Oxbow ledger, then seal the archive key shares. Plugin authors may observe but not handle shares. Once sealed, the archive index itself is encrypted and can only be reopened with the passphrase below.

vault phrase of badup-hahig = tamael-aldael-kelmir-istael-fenok-istwyn-tamius-jorath-oliion

Subject: On-call handover — Merrow calendar sync

Taking over from me tonight: the Merrow sync worker is double-booking events when a recurring meeting is edited mid-series. Patch is in review; see branch sync-conflict-fix. Conflict resolution now prefers the upstream timestamp — flag anything that looks lossy. Don't restart the worker during a sync window. If the reviewer needs context on the dedupe logic, ping the calendar team at the address below.

alerts address for kajog-tadup: druox@plorvanet.internal

## Releases

Hey support folks — quick notes on ProfileMesh shard releases. Each release re-balances user-profile shards gradually, so don't panic if a lookup lands on a stale shard for a few minutes post-deploy; it self-heals. Release bundles are published twice a month and are always signed. If a customer asks you to verify a bundle they downloaded, walk them through the checksum step using the public signing key below.

deploy key for kawif-bageg: bky19_YQNdHDgpaLxUNwPoHm9